After China’s Guangxi province officially resumed customs clearance at border gates and border crossings in its Dongxing city, some 200 trucks carrying goods were cleared to cross the border on January 10. The resumption came after a hiatus of nearly 20 days. The sub-department said as of 1pm on January 10, there were more than 1,300 trucks, mostly transporting frozen and fresh seafood and fresh fruit, left to be cleared.
Previously, Guangxi temporarily suspended customs clearance at border gates in Dongxing city from December 21, 2021. These freshly reopened pairs of border gates and border crossings are very important for imports and exports of both sides.
